Cycling Tour Along Windsor's Waterfront: A Historical and Cultural Journey

The upcoming cycling tour along Windsor's waterfront is an exciting opportunity for residents and visitors alike to explore the city's rich history and vibrant cultural scene. This guided bike ride, organized by Museum Windsor, promises to be an engaging and informative experience, offering a unique perspective on the city's landmarks and its fascinating relationship with Detroit.

A Historical Journey Along the Riverfront

What makes this tour particularly captivating is its focus on interpreting monuments, art sculptures, and unique Windsor-Detroit history. As riders pedal along the riverfront, they will encounter a variety of stops that bring the city's past to life. From the Great Canadian Flag to the Ambassador Bridge, each location will provide a deeper understanding of Windsor's development and its connection to its neighboring city.

Practical Information and Registration

The tour is scheduled for 11 a.m. to 1 p.m., and the starting location will be provided upon registration. Tickets are priced at $10 each, and pre-registration is essential due to limited space. Interested participants can call 519-253-1812 or visit the Chimczuk Museum in person to secure their spot.
